背景情况:
- 慢性非细菌性骨髓炎 (CNO) 和SAPHO综合征是影响骨系统的罕见自身炎症性疾病.
- 这些情况可以涉及皮肤,更少的情况,肠道和肺系统.
- 虽然注意到家族聚类,但CNO的潜在遗传原因在很大程度上仍然不清楚.

主要成果:
- 在LPIN2,IL1RN和FBLIM1中罕见的功能变异表明在某些CNO病例中存在单基遗传.
- 像HLA-B*27和P2RX7变体这样的常见易感性因素表明复杂的遗传模式.
- 土耳其人群中与家族地中海热病的遗传相似性表明共享的途径.
结论:
- CNO的遗传场景异质,涉及罕见的致病变体和常见的易感因素.
- 了解CNO的遗传背景具有潜在的治疗意义.
- 由于完全阐明的CNO病例数量有限,进一步的遗传研究至关重要.

What is Population Genetics?
64.5K
A population is composed of members of the same species that simultaneously live and interact in the same area. When individuals in a population breed, they pass down their genes to their offspring. Many of these genes are polymorphic, meaning that they occur in multiple variants. Such variations of a gene are referred to as alleles. The collective set of all the alleles within a population is known as the gene pool.

Types of Genetic Transfer Between Organisms
30.6K
Genetic transfer occurs when genetic information is passed from one organism to another. It occurs via two mechanisms: vertical gene transfer and horizontal gene transfer. Vertical gene transfer occurs when genetic information is transferred from one generation to the next, which happens much more frequently than horizontal gene transfer. Both sexual and asexual reproduction are forms of vertical gene transfer, where one or more organisms pass some or all of their genome onto their progeny.
